Le 22/04/2005 - 21:11
J’ai assisté au match Israel - France le jour-même de mon arrivée en Israel.
Bilan : un 1 partout mérité, quoique Israel aurait pu concrétiser un deuxième but en fin de jeu.
Anecdotes :
J’ai fait fureur auprès des français avec mes affiches


Au but israélien, les Israéliens ont sauté dans la foule, on s’est cassé la gueule sur les sièges…
On a appris de belles chansons de “guerre”
Les détails et toutes les photos sur le site dédié.
Classé dans Voyages, Judaïsme |
- [Imprimer]
|
Le 14/04/2005 - 15:58
Problème
A l’install, la base fonctionne normalement. Au premier shutdown ou arrêt du service Oracle, impossible de redémarrer.
Le processus Oradim.exe lancé pour démarrer le service (OracleServiceORCL par exemple) ne veut pas se terminer et donc le service est toujours en mode “starting…”.
Dès qu’on “kill” manuellement ce process, le service est démarré normalement; il reste alorsà monter la base en lançant les commandes suivantes :
svrmgrl
connect internal
startup
exit
L’arrêt pose aussi le même problème, il faut démonter la base puis arrêter le service ensuite.
Mais comment rendre tout ça automatique (en cas de reboot automatique par exemple ou lors des sauvegardes offline de nuit) ?
Solution de contournement
J’ai créé les scripts suivants :
* stopOracle.cmd
@ECHO OFF
svrmgrl command="@stopSVRMGRL.txt"
net stop OracleServiceORCL
exit
avec le contenu de stopSVRMGRL.txt:
connect internal
shutdown
quit
Ce script fonctionne parfaitement.
Pour le démarrage, c’était plus difficile car il fallait pouvoir tuer un processus automatiquement. Heureusement j’ai trouvé Process203 !
Mais il me restait encore un problème : il fallait tuer le processus Oradim.exe une fois que le service était démarré (et donc le tuer en parallèle) et surtout, lui laisser le temps de démarrer…
Alors j’ai trouvé une technique sur internet pour émuler le “sleep”.
Et voilà le résultat :
* startOracle.cmd
@ECHO OFF
echo "Démarrage d'Oracle..."
start /MIN StartAdminOracle.cmd
net start OracleServiceORCL
svrmgrl command=”@startSVRMGRL.txt”
exit
avec le contenu de startAdminOracle.cmd:
@ECHO OFF
rem attend 15 seconds avant d'effectuer son action
ping -n 16 localhost> NUL
C:Process203process -k oradim.exe
exit
et le contenu de startSVRMGRL.txt :
connect internal
startup
quit
Au passage, ces deux fichiers de commande sont appelés respectivement avant et après le backup offline de nuit.
Classé dans Trucs de geeks |
- [Imprimer]
|